Financial crime prevention in focus

Muscat, February 26, 2014

International law firm Trowers & Hamlins are set to host a seminar about the Middle East’s biggest financial collapse caused by financial crime on March 3 in Muscat.

The breakfast seminar, which will be held at the Grand Hyatt, will discuss tackling corruption, white collar crime and ways to combat financial fraud.  

It will specifically examine a case study of The International Banking Corporation (TIBC), which has been one of the financial institutions at the centre of the biggest financial collapse in the Middle East.

Partners Abdullah Mutawi and Lucas Pitts will lead the seminar, said a statement.

Abdullah Mutawi is a cross-border M&A and corporate finance lawyer and advises on high profile insolvency, administration, corporate distress and re-structuring matters.  

Lucas Pitts is regional head of commercial dispute resolution for Trowers & Hamlins and, together with Abdullah, leads the litigation arising out of the administration of TIBC, which has involved advising on claims before the courts in Saudi Arabia, Bahrain and New York, including a professional negligence claim against the former auditors for approximately $3 billion. - TradeArabia News Service
